Grant CommentsClass II Permissive Change. Improve radar detect function via software. Power Output listed is average conducted. Device is an 802.11a/b/g/n/ac device in 2x2 (802.11b/g/n) and 4X4 (802.11a/n/ac) Spatial Multiplexing MIMO configuration as described in this filing.The antennas used for this transmitter must be installed to provide a separation distance of at least 20 cm from all persons and not be colocated with any other transmitters except in accordance with FCC multitransmitter product procedures. End-users and installers must be provided with antenna installation instructions and transmitter operating conditions for satisfying RF exposure compliance. This device has a 20 MHz, 40 MHz and 80 MHz bandwidth mode.
